Lego Universe launched in October 2010 with massive ambition. It blended the creative freedom of physical Lego bricks with the social, quest-driven mechanics of traditional MMOs. Players joined factions like the Nexus Force, battled the chaotic Maelstrom, and built custom creations on personal properties. lego universe client 1.10 64 unpacked

Unfortunately, despite a dedicated fanbase, the servers were closed just over a year later, on January 30, 2012. The official world went dark, leaving a void for countless players. But from this void, a new story began. Fans and developers couldn't let the game disappear forever, leading to the creation of community-run server emulators. Most preservationists acquire the 1.10.64 unpacked files via community-vetted digital archives, such as the Internet Archive (Archive.org) or dedicated GitHub preservation repositories, ensuring that the file hashes match original manifests to avoid corrupted data or malware.
